Is 358 791 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 358 791 is about 598.992.

Thus, the square root of 358 791 is not an integer, and therefore 358 791 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 358 791?

The square of a number (here 358 791) is the result of the product of this number (358 791) by itself (i.e., 358 791 × 358 791); the square of 358 791 is sometimes called "raising 358 791 to the power 2", or "358 791 squared".

The square of 358 791 is 128 730 981 681 because 358 791 × 358 791 = 358 7912 = 128 730 981 681.

As a consequence, 358 791 is the square root of 128 730 981 681.
